2025 loan limits and downpayment requirments in Hollister, county of San Benito, CA

Loan Type Loan Limit Down payment
USDA $776,600 0%
FHA $1,089,300 3.5%
Conventional Conforming $1,089,300 3%

What is USDA Loan in California?

USDA home loan is a loan guaranteed by the government Department of Agriculture AKA USDA rural development loan or USDA mortgage and is available in rural neighborhoods only. Unlike FHA loans that require a minimum of 3.5% down payment, the USDA mortgage loan does not require any down payment.
